Property Insights of Urea, 1-(2-chloroethyl)-3-(1-methylcyclopentyl)-1-nitroso-

The XLogP value of 1.6 suggests moderate lipophilicity, balancing water solubility and membrane permeability for Urea, 1-(2-chloroethyl)-3-(1-methylcyclopentyl)-1-nitroso-. The TPSA of 61.8 Ų falls within the moderate polarity range, balancing permeability and solubility for Urea, 1-(2-chloroethyl)-3-(1-methylcyclopentyl)-1-nitroso-. Following Lipinski's Rule of Five, Urea, 1-(2-chloroethyl)-3-(1-methylcyclopentyl)-1-nitroso- has 1 hydrogen bond donor(s) and 3 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
